When customising a template from a plugin pressing the browser back button does not update the template list #37585

If you customise a template in the Site Editor, then press the browser back button, attempting to edit the same item again (without refreshing the template page) theYou attempted to edit an item that doesn't exist. Perhaps it was deleted? error shows up.

Step-by-step reproduction instructions

  1. Install WooCommerce Blocks (or any other extension that adds templates to Gutenberg).
  2. Go to the site editor templates list.
  3. Find a template from a plugin that has not been customised.
  4. Customise it and press save.
  5. Use the browser back button to return to the template list.
  6. Try to edit the same template again.
  7. See the error
